What the job involves
- We are seeking a Senior Specialist, Product Management for a one-year fixed-term contract reporting to the Director of Send Standards Compliance
- This role sits within the Mastercard Send Standards & Compliance team, part of the Global Send Product organization
- The team defines, maintains, and enforces money transfer standards for Mastercard Send. This role will play a key part in strengthening compliance controls, improving data quality, and ensuring consistent application of Send standards across the network
- This is a highly collaborative, global role requiring close partnership with regional and global Send teams, as well as Legal, Regulatory, Franchise, and Compliance
- Design and implement automated capabilities to detect, monitor, and address non-compliance with Send program standards
- Partner with cross-functional stakeholders to develop and deploy network controls that enforce compliance with Mastercard rules and data standards
- Analyze transaction and customer data to identify compliance gaps, improve data integrity, and drive actionable insights
- Lead the rollout of network controls, ensuring transactions contain required data elements and are properly structured
- Contribute to both short-term enhancements and long-term strategy for Send standards enforcement and control frameworks
- Support broader Mastercard Send product initiatives and continuous improvement efforts
- Represent Mastercard in customer engagements and industry forums, as needed
- Respond to internal and external inquiries related to Send standards and controls
- Promote awareness and adoption of upcoming global Send standards and publications
- Identify opportunities to simplify and streamline Mastercard Send data standards
